It has come to the attention of forum staff that Dollshe Craft has ceased communications with dealers and customers, has failed to provide promised refunds for the excessive waits, and now has wait times surpassing 5 years in some cases. Forum staff are also concerned as there are claims being put forth that Dollshe plans to close down their doll making company. Due to the instability of the company, the lack of communication, the lack of promised refunds, and the wait times now surpassing 5 years, we strongly urge members to research the current state of this company very carefully and thoroughly before deciding to place an order. For more information please see the Dollshe waiting room. Do not assume this cannot happen to you or that your order will be different.

    5. umm what eye size does unoa take? TT 3 TT
       
    6. Depends on the brand (some brands are physically larger and and some brands have larger irises) and may depend on the mold. I think Lusis's eye openings are a bit smaller than Sist's.

      I have seen 10mm, 11mm and 12mm used. I could be wrong but I think 10mm in Gumdrops, 11mm in Eyeco, Ginarolo I am not sure but she has some photos of Sist in her eye sale thread and they say what size. I believe the drilled Glastics that come with Unoa are 12mm. It depends.

      What's the difference between 1.5 and 2.0 ??
       
    13. 1.5 are the Lusis and Sist doll, which are MSD size.
      2.0 are the Cream and Mocha doll, also MSD, but one has tanned skin and one doesnt, their body mold is more mature (like fashion dolls ;)) their feets are in highheels by the way... I'm considering of getting one if I cannot wait for the next 1.5 preorder....

    17. Just a heads up for others that might have been thinking along the same lines as I was...
      The AoD resin has changed. It no longer matches unoa at all. It's now pink. :(
      I was going to put my madoromi B-el head on an AoD body, but got the body today, and it's just way too pink.
      It does, however, match Dollmore fairly well, so I'm just swapping bodies here.
      My Dollmore head is now on the AoD body (and I blushed it to match fairly well), and the B-el head will be on the Dollmore body as soon as the headback comes in. :)
      Now, I could have just blushed the B-el head to match as well, but he said he liked the DM body for himself better anyway.

      So, anyway, long story short: AoD normal no longer matches unoa. :(
